Transaction 39d3169f7dc7c76de6912dc250b8213e3937b4048e058a88736787e4c4c8d256

2 Input
1 Outputs
  • 39d3169f7dc7c76de6912dc250b8213e3937b4048e058a88736787e4c4c8d256:0
  • value  594080
    address  3EtgK97nF6TVDo1zDDttVN1kFFnALjN8DH